San Miguel Beer returned to the PBA Season 49 Philippine Cup win column by decisively defeating Phoenix with a score of 111-92.
The Beermen, now holding a 4-2 record, recovered from their previous loss to TNT and are aiming for a top 4 spot.
Don Trollano, who had a scoreless performance in the last game, was named Player of the Game with 21 points and was a key spark in the second quarter.
CJ Perez led San Miguel with a match-high 26 points, including late triples that thwarted Phoenix's comeback attempts.
June Mar Fajardo contributed a double-double with 20 points and 12 rebounds, while Marcio Lassiter added 11 points.
A dominant 34-21 second quarter run, anchored by Trollano, allowed San Miguel to build a significant lead.
The win also highlighted a strong contribution of 46 points from the San Miguel bench, a significant improvement from their previous game.
